#pragma once

#include "IntSize.h"
#include "MediaSample.h"
#include <wtf/RetainPtr.h>

typedef struct CGImage *CGImageRef;
typedef struct OpaqueVTPixelTransferSession* VTPixelTransferSessionRef;
typedef struct __CVBuffer *CVPixelBufferRef;
typedef struct __CVPixelBufferPool *CVPixelBufferPoolRef;
typedef struct __IOSurface *IOSurfaceRef;
typedef struct opaqueCMSampleBuffer *CMSampleBufferRef;

namespace WebCore {

class RemoteVideoSample;

class ImageTransferSessionVT {
public:
    static std::unique_ptr<ImageTransferSessionVT> create(uint32_t pixelFormat, bool shouldUseIOSurface = true)
    {
        return std::unique_ptr<ImageTransferSessionVT>(new ImageTransferSessionVT(pixelFormat, shouldUseIOSurface));
    }

    RefPtr<MediaSample> convertMediaSample(MediaSample&, const IntSize&);
    RefPtr<MediaSample> createMediaSample(CGImageRef, const MediaTime&, const IntSize&, MediaSample::VideoRotation = MediaSample::VideoRotation::None, bool mirrored = false);
    RefPtr<MediaSample> createMediaSample(CMSampleBufferRef, const MediaTime&, const IntSize&, MediaSample::VideoRotation = MediaSample::VideoRotation::None, bool mirrored = false);

#if !PLATFORM(MACCATALYST)
    WEBCORE_EXPORT RefPtr<MediaSample> createMediaSample(IOSurfaceRef, const MediaTime&, const IntSize&, MediaSample::VideoRotation = MediaSample::VideoRotation::None, bool mirrored = false);
#if ENABLE(MEDIA_STREAM)
    WEBCORE_EXPORT RefPtr<MediaSample> createMediaSample(const RemoteVideoSample&);
#endif
#endif

    uint32_t pixelFormat() const { return m_pixelFormat; }

private:
    WEBCORE_EXPORT ImageTransferSessionVT(uint32_t pixelFormat, bool shouldUseIOSurface);

#if !PLATFORM(MACCATALYST)
    RetainPtr<CMSampleBufferRef> createCMSampleBuffer(IOSurfaceRef, const MediaTime&, const IntSize&);
#endif

    RetainPtr<CMSampleBufferRef> convertCMSampleBuffer(CMSampleBufferRef, const IntSize&, const MediaTime* = nullptr);
    RetainPtr<CMSampleBufferRef> createCMSampleBuffer(CVPixelBufferRef, const MediaTime&, const IntSize&);
    RetainPtr<CMSampleBufferRef> createCMSampleBuffer(CGImageRef, const MediaTime&, const IntSize&);

    RetainPtr<CVPixelBufferRef> convertPixelBuffer(CVPixelBufferRef, const IntSize&);
    RetainPtr<CVPixelBufferRef> createPixelBuffer(CMSampleBufferRef, const IntSize&);
    RetainPtr<CVPixelBufferRef> createPixelBuffer(CGImageRef, const IntSize&);

    bool setSize(const IntSize&);

    RetainPtr<VTPixelTransferSessionRef> m_transferSession;
    RetainPtr<CVPixelBufferPoolRef> m_outputBufferPool;
    bool m_shouldUseIOSurface { true };
    uint32_t m_pixelFormat;
    IntSize m_size;
};

}
